How and Why is Crime More Concentrated in Some Neighborhoods than Others?: A New Dimension to Community Crime

Objectives Much recent work has focused on how crime concentrates on particular streets within communities. This is the first study to examine how such concentrations vary across the neighborhoods of a city. The analysis evaluates the extent to which neighborhoods have characteristic levels of crime...
